The Allure of the Dutch Grand Prix

The Dutch Grand Prix returned to the Formula 1 calendar in recent years, much to the delight of fans, especially those in the Netherlands. Held at the historic Circuit Zandvoort, the race offers a unique blend of challenging turns and exhilarating straightaways, making it a favorite among drivers and spectators alike. Understanding Betting Types

Before placing your bets, you must familiarize yourself with the various types of bets available. Here’s a breakdown of the most common types you’ll encounter when betting on the Dutch Grand Prix:

  • Outright Winner: This is the most straightforward bet, where you simply predict which driver will win the race.
  • Podium Finish: Here, you bet on whether a driver will finish in one of the top three positions.
  • Head-to-Head: This type of bet compares two drivers, and you wager on which one will finish higher in the race.
  • Fastest Lap: You can bet on which driver will record the fastest lap during the race.

Common Betting Mistakes

To improve your betting strategy, you must recognize common mistakes that many make. Here are a few to watch out for:

  • Chasing Losses: It’s tempting to increase your bets after a loss in hopes of recovering quickly. This can lead to significant financial strain.
  • Betting on Your Favorite Team: While it’s natural to support your favorite driver or team, emotional betting can cloud your judgment. Try to remain objective.
  • Ignoring Current Form: Always assess a driver’s recent performances. A good past record does not guarantee current success.

The Role of Odds

Understanding how betting odds work is crucial. Odds reflect the probability of an outcome and can fluctuate leading up to the event based on various factors, including betting volumes and team changes. Be sure to compare odds across different betting platforms to ensure you’re getting the best value for your wager.
